Grosscup Boundary of the Panamint The Panamint Shoshone, also referred to as the Panamint, Koso (Coso) and Shoshone of eastern California, lived in that portion of the Basin and Range Province which extends from the Sierra Nevadas on the west to the Amargosa Desert of eastern Nevada on the east, and from Owens Valley and Fish Lake Valley in the north to an ill- defined boundary in the south shared with Southern Paiute groups. These boundaries will be discussed below. Previous attempts to define the Panamint Shoshone boundary have been made by Kroeber (1925), Steward (1933, 1937, 1938, 1939 and 1941) and Driver (1937). Others, who have worked with some of the groups which border the Panamint Shoshone, have something to say about the common boundary between the group of their special interest and the Panamint Shoshone (e.g., Voegelin 1938; Zigmond 1938; and Kelly 1934). Kroeber (1925: 589-560) wrote: "The territory of the westernmost member of this group [the Shoshone], our Koso, who form as it were the head of a serpent that curves across the map for 1, 500 miles, is one of the largest of any Californian people. It was also perhaps the most thinly populated, and one of the least defined. If there were boundaries, they are not known. To the west the crest of the Sierra has been assumed as the limit of the Koso toward the Tubatulabal. On the north were the eastern Mono of Owens River. -

Kellere Department of Physics, California Polytechnic State University, San Luis Obispo, California 93407 ͑Received 15 February 2010; accepted 27 August 2010͒ We suggest that the existence of many of the rock-carved trails at Racetrack Playa in Death Valley National Park is predominantly due to the effect of arbitrarily weak winds on rocks that are floated off the soft bed by small rafts of ice, as also occurs in arctic tidal beaches to form boulder barricades. These ice cakes need not have a particularly large surface area if the ice is adequately thick—the ice cakes allow the rocks to move by buoyantly reducing the reaction and friction forces at the bed, not by increasing the wind drag. The parameter space of ice thickness and extent versus rock size for flotation is calculated and found to be reasonable. 1 INTRODUCTION This monograph is an introductory descriptive grammar of Tlimpisa Shoshone, meant to provide both layman and specialist with a basic understanding of how the language works as a linguistic system. In this sense, it is intended to be a "nuts and bolts" grammar with lots of examples illustrating the most important grammatical elements and processes in the language. 1 Tlimpisa Shoshone is a dialect of the language most often called Panamint in the technical literature (e.g., Freeze and Iannucci 1979, Henshaw 1883, Kroeber 1939, Lamb 1958a and 1964, McLaughlin 1987, Miller 1984) . The language is also known as Panamint Shoshone (Fowler and Fowler 1971, Merriam 1904, Miller et al. 1971), Koso (= Coso) or Koso Shoshone (Kroeber 1925, Lamb 1958a), and simply Shoshone (Steward 1938). Panamint and two other closely related languages, Shoshone proper and Comanche, comprise the Central Numic branch of the Numic subfamily of the northern division of the uto-Aztecan family of American Indian languages (see Lamb 1964, Miller 1984, Kaufman and Campbell 1981). Speakers of uto-Aztecan languages occupied more territory in aboriginal America than any other group. More than 30 Uto-Aztecan languages were spoken over a vast area stretching from the Salmon River in central Idaho south through the Great Basin and peripheral areas into the Southwest and through northern and central Mexico.
